今天把公司的服务器折腾了下,搭建了FTP服务器。
环境1: windows server 2003
1、安装FTP支持组件
控制面板--添加或删除程序--添加/删除windows组件(等一会儿之后弹出窗口)
双击“应用程序服务器”--双击“internet信息服务”--勾选“文件传输协议(FTP)服务”--确定
早先已经安装IIS程序。
2、新建FTP用户
针对使用ftp功能的人员配置用户名和密码(当然也可以是使用匿名访问)
管理工具-计算机管理--系统工具--本地用户和组--用户--反键新用户
3、新建FTP服务器
管理工具--iis管理器--FTP站点目录下新建站点--输入描述(任意)--分配IP地址和端口(选择本机,默认21)--下一步--下一步
设置路径指向你想要进行ftp操作的文件夹--访问权限(读取写入)--一路确定。
在新建好的ftp站点上反键属性--安全账户--匿名访问去掉勾选。
在新建好的ftp站点上反键选择权限,添加2中新建的用户(添加--高级--立即查找--选择),权限完全控制勾选。确定。
默认使用自动新建的应用程序池。
浏览器通过ftp:ip:21访问ftp服务器
推荐程序8uftp
环境2: windows server 2012
1、安装FTP支持组件
服务器管理器--仪表板--管理--添加角色和功能--服务器角色--web服务器(iis)--ftp服务器--勾选ftp服务
服务器管理器--仪表板--管理--添加角色和功能--服务器角色--web服务器(iis)--管理工具--勾选iis管理控制台和iis6管理兼容性
早先已经安装iis服务器
2、新建FTP用户
针对使用ftp功能的人员配置用户名和密码(当然也可以是使用匿名访问)
在控制面板--用户账户--管理账户--添加用户账户。
3、新建FTP服务器
打开原有的iis管理器--网站--添加FTP站点--名字、路径--ip、端口、ssl--身份验证选择基本、允许访问指定用户、2中新建的用户。
默认使用自动新建的应用程序池。
配置错误了的话可以在FTP身份验证中选择验证方式(匿名、基本用户、自定义)
在FTP授权规则中添加修改指定的用户。
FTP方式更新服务器程序弊端是不能有效备份、不能回滚。
因此比较实用的方式是使用svn来实现。没实验过,不表。
原文:http://www.cnblogs.com/hahanonym/p/4916073.html